How Much is a Private Urology Consultation in the UK?

Initial consultation (30 - 45 min): £220 to £350.

Follow-up visit: £150 to £250.

PSA and blood panel: £90 to £180.

Ultrasound or uroflowmetry add-on: £200 to £400.

Multiparametric MRI prostate: £750 to £1 200.

Regional Price Differences in the UK

London (Central): Consultant urologists charge £300 - £450 per initial visit.

Manchester, Birmingham, Leeds: Expect £220 - £330.

Smaller cities (Edinburgh, Cardiff, Newcastle): Clinics quote £200 - £300, though advanced imaging may require travel.

Factors that Affect Urology Consultation Pricing

🚻 Diagnostic tests

PSA, urinalysis, or ultrasound performed during the visit increase costs.

👨‍⚕️ Consultant expertise

Subspecialists in prostate cancer or reconstructive urology charge more than generalists.

📋 Report requirements

Detailed medico-legal or insurance reports add £50 - £150.

🏥 Hospital setting

Private hospitals with surgical theatres cost more than outpatient clinics.

📍 Location

Central London consultations have higher room and staffing costs.

How to Save Money on Private Urology Care

📦 Bring previous tests

Sharing NHS imaging or labs prevents repeat diagnostics.

🧾 Use PMI cover

Private insurance often covers consultations and procedures when authorised by your GP.

🚆 Travel to regional centres

Seeing the same consultant at a regional hospital can cut fees by £100+ per visit.

🧘 Adjust lifestyle first

Hydration, bladder training, and pelvic floor exercises may resolve mild symptoms without extra procedures.

FAQs

Do I need a referral?

Self-pay patients can book directly, but insurers usually require a GP referral for authorisation.

How quickly can I be seen?

Most private clinics offer appointments within a week, and urgent prostate symptoms can be triaged within 48 hours.

What if I need surgery?

Your urologist can book private theatre time or refer you back to the NHS with detailed notes to expedite treatment.

Will consultations impact my NHS care?

Private visits run alongside NHS care - sharing reports with your GP ensures both pathways stay aligned.
